Yes, but that's probably only good for a 400-500 watt inverter. The wire gauge is too small (i'm not sure what it is, but I can't imaging it's heavier than 12 gauge.
I'm going to be doing a 1200W inverter which can drive tools and appliances. For that big an inverter and the distance from the battery (I'm estimating 12-14 feet) you really need a fused #1/0 or #2/0 gauge cable to be safe. You might be able to get by with something a little bit lighter weight, but I'll err on the heavier side.
